## Onboarding: Batching Fix

Welcome aboard. Your first task touches the Ledgerbird GraphQL API. We recently fixed an N+1 in the `orders.lineItems` resolver using the Fanloader batcher; read `fanloader.md` before changing resolvers. Run the benchmark suite locally to confirm query counts stay flat. The staging gateway requires the internal metrics key, which is below.

gateway credential: zpat15_lMLOSdhT94y0U3l

FAQ: How do I localize date formats in Quillbase?

All date rendering in Quillbase goes through the Tempora formatting layer; never hand-build strings with string concatenation. Pick the user's locale from the session context, pass it to Tempora, and the correct day/month ordering, separators, and month names come out automatically. Contractors sometimes hardcode a regional pattern for testing — don't, because it leaks into snapshots. If you need to unlock the locale fixtures bundle for offline work, use the passphrase shown below.

strongbox words: norwyn-wenael-aldvan-aldiel-wendor-holael

**Ticket #—: Vault locked, blocking flaky test triage (Ledgermint payments)**

Integration tests for Ledgermint settlement keep flaking; suspect stale sandbox credentials. Can't rotate them — the test-secrets vault locked after failed fetches from CI. Support: please unlock so we can rerun the suite before the cutoff. The vault accepts the standard recovery passphrase, noted below:

strongbox words: gilok-druion-briath-wendor-briion-prawyn-fenion-oliir-casdor-holius-briius-gilath-gilael-pelys